The AFV ASSOCIATION was formed in 1964 to support the thoughts and research of all those interested in Armored Fighting Vehicles and related topics, such as AFV drawings. The emphasis has always been on sharing information and communicating with other members of similar interests; e.g. German armor, Japanese AFVs, or whatever.

- Massimo_Foti
I see a 105 mm Sherman here, I guess I can rely on P-o for knowing the exact model Smile


That's an M4(105) HVSS, serial number 58486, built at Chrysler in October, 1944. It has USMC markings

yes it is. Its serial number is unknown yet.. it was built by Pressed Steel Car sometime in 1944. It has been rebuilt in the 1950s and sent to an European country as Military Defense Assistance Program.
